Annie Riley, a leadership coach and host of 'Who Got Me Here?', shares insights on redefining networking as genuine relationship-building. Dori Clark, a business professor, emphasizes the importance of investing in relationships and waiting before asking for favors. Allison Wood Brooks, a Harvard professor, introduces the topic pyramid technique to facilitate meaningful conversations. Together, they provide actionable strategies for in-person networking, easing anxiety, and shifting from small talk to deeper interactions.

INSIGHT

Networking Is Relationship Building

  • Networking is relationship building, not transactional favors or name-dropping.
  • Treat people as humans first and appreciate them for who they are, not just what they can do for you.
ADVICE

Be Long-Term Greedy

  • Be "long-term greedy" by investing in relationships before asking for favors.
  • Let relationships bloom so your future asks feel natural and not transactional.
ADVICE

Delay Asking For Favors

  • Wait before asking favors; give relationships time to strengthen (Dori Clark suggests up to a year).
  • Avoid ending early conversations by immediately asking about job openings or referrals.
